Transaction 6821177b802a53569aae2d0bc596f82d7df624ed0db1f926ee976361a01fef74

1 Input
2 Outputs
  • 6821177b802a53569aae2d0bc596f82d7df624ed0db1f926ee976361a01fef74:0
  • value  755040
    address  19K3UtHpZXCwJBRJx3X12p2RSNjZLaHGq
  • 6821177b802a53569aae2d0bc596f82d7df624ed0db1f926ee976361a01fef74:1
  • value  128102361
    address  bc1qd95apcjs3dfl597kj68ejyfhmt5dvz6w60uzgx